What is Binomial Nomenclature

Scientific naming of organisms.


ie. Genus species, Homo sapiens...

What is Taxonomy

The study of the classification of all life on Earth.

List the Levels of Classification

Domain, Kingdom, Phylum, Class, Order, Family, Genus, Species

Drunken Kangaroos Punching Children On Family Game Shows

Name the Three Domains

Archaea, Bacteria, Eukarya.

Name the Six Kingdoms.

Animalia, Monera, Archaea, Protista, Plantae, Fungi.

Animalia Characteristics.

Eukaryotic, multicellular, heterotrophic, no cell walls.

Protista Characteristics

Eukaryotic, mostly unicellular

Monera Characteristics.

Unicellular, prokaryotic

Fungi Characteristics

Heterotrophic, eukaryotic, multicellular, decomposes dead organisms for food

Plantae Characteristics

Multicellular, cell walls, autotrophic, eukaryotic

Archaea Characteristics

Prokaryotic, unicellular, lives in harsh environments, chemotrophs
